Understanding the Basics of Braking Systems
First off, we gotta understand the different types of braking systems out there. There are mainly two types that are commonly used with MC Series Motors: electromagnetic brakes and mechanical brakes.
Electromagnetic brakes are super popular. They work by using an electromagnetic field to engage the brake. When the power is on, the brake is released, and when the power is cut off, the brake engages. These brakes are great because they’re fast-acting and can be controlled electronically. They’re also pretty reliable and can handle high speeds and heavy loads.
On the other hand, mechanical brakes use physical force to stop the motor. They usually have a friction material that presses against a rotating part of the motor to slow it down. Mechanical brakes are simple and durable, but they might not be as fast as electromagnetic brakes.
Factors to Consider When Selecting a Braking System
Now, let’s talk about the factors you need to consider when choosing a braking system for your MC Series Motor.
Motor Specifications
The first thing you need to look at is the motor’s specifications. You gotta know things like the motor’s power rating, speed, and torque. The power rating will tell you how much energy the motor can handle, and this will affect the type of brake you need. For example, if you have a high-power motor, you’ll need a brake that can handle the extra force.
The speed of the motor is also important. If your motor runs at a high speed, you’ll need a brake that can stop it quickly. And the torque, which is the rotational force of the motor, will determine how much braking force you need.
Application Requirements
Think about how you’re going to use the motor. Is it for a heavy-duty industrial application, or is it for a more light-duty task? If it’s for a heavy-duty application, you’ll need a more robust braking system. For example, if you’re using the motor in a conveyor belt system that moves heavy materials, you’ll need a brake that can handle the constant stop-and-go motion and the heavy load.
On the other hand, if it’s for a light-duty application, like a small machine in a workshop, you might not need such a powerful brake.
Environment
The environment where the motor will be used is also a big factor. If the motor is going to be used in a dirty or dusty environment, you’ll need a brake that’s sealed to prevent dirt and debris from getting in. If it’s going to be used in a wet or corrosive environment, you’ll need a brake that’s made of materials that can resist corrosion.

Types of Brakes for MC Series Motors
Now that we’ve talked about the factors to consider, let’s take a closer look at the different types of brakes that are suitable for MC Series Motors.
Electromagnetic Fail-Safe Brakes
These are a great option for MC Series Motors. They’re called fail-safe because they engage when the power is cut off. This means that if there’s a power outage or a problem with the motor, the brake will automatically engage, preventing the motor from running out of control.
Electromagnetic fail-safe brakes are also very precise. You can control the amount of braking force by adjusting the current to the brake. This makes them ideal for applications where you need to stop the motor quickly and accurately.
Spring-Applied Brakes
Spring-applied brakes are another type of electromagnetic brake. They work by using a spring to apply the braking force. When the power is on, the electromagnetic field overcomes the spring force, and the brake is released. When the power is off, the spring applies the braking force.
These brakes are very reliable and can handle high loads. They’re also easy to install and maintain.
Eddy Current Brakes
Eddy current brakes use the principle of electromagnetic induction to create a braking force. When the motor is running, a magnetic field is created, which induces eddy currents in a conductive disc. These eddy currents create a braking force that slows down the motor.
Eddy current brakes are great for applications where you need a smooth and continuous braking force. They’re also very efficient and can handle high speeds.
